Question...HTML Emails
« on: October 22, 2007, 07:57:03 PM »
How easy is it to create a best buy/circuit city like email to be sent out to people.  Basically the email would contain many images that when clicked on would take the user to the product to purchase on the website.  I created a mock email of what I want it to look like through Photoshop.  I was assuming I could image map it, which I did and works fine but how would I email an image map out to the public?  Or is there an easier way to do this?

Re: Question...HTML Emails
« Reply #2 on: October 23, 2007, 01:13:03 PM »
You can use php to send out mass emails (html and plain text). Most spammers use this method because it's cheap and easy. You're not trying to start spamming people are you?
I really don't recommend using an image map. Some people don't have html enabled for their inbox. They wouldn't be able to see anything, in that case.
Best thing to do is to use as much text as possible, and less images. The message will load faster that way too.
